MNRF issues flood warnings

0
0

The Ministry of Natural Resources and Forestry – Pembroke District is advising area residents that a Flood Warning is in effect for the Bonnechere River below the Town of Renfrew to the Ottawa River in Renfrew County.
For the remainder of Renfrew County a Water Conditions Statement – Water Safety remains in effect.
Residents of Renfrew County should be advised that localized flooding is occurring along the Bonnechere River below the Town of Renfrew between the Renfrew Power Generation dam at Bridge Street and the Ottawa River. For the reminder of the County, residents should keep a close watch on conditions, regularly check for updated messages and exercise caution near fast-moving rivers and streams. Residents who have a historic susceptibility to flooding should take appropriate precautions to protect their property, such as ensuring sump pumps are functioning and securing items that may float away as water levels rise.
MNRF is closely monitoring the weather and developing watershed conditions. Further updates will be issued as appropriate.
